Honda and GS Yuasa in EV battery production joint venture

Honda Motor and GS Yuasa, a Japanese battery maker, will invest more than $2.99 billion to develop and mass-produce cells for electric vehicles and homes in Japan through a joint venture. Nissan Ariya gets top sustainability rating in Green NCAP testing

The Nissan Ariya electric vehicle has received a 5-star rating and a Weighted Overall Index of 9.6 in Green NCAP testing, an independent initiative that evaluates cars’ sustainability credentials.
